Recently, biochar emerged as a promising peroxide activator due to its chemical-saving/facile synthesis processes, high efficiency, tunable physicochemical properties and capacity to endow both radical and non-radical oxidative species. However, serious knowledge gaps and controversies have been raised on the mechanism to modulate reactive sites on its surface and dominated reaction pathways in biochar-involving systems. Insight understanding of the activation processes will remarkably advance its functional synthesis and application in practical wastewater treatment. Therefore, this paper aims to provide an up-to-date review on application and modification of biochar activator to alter their reactive sites and physicochemical properties and design their synthesis processes to achieve a satisfactory performance. Also, formation of reactive oxidative species on various reactive sites was discussed. Lastly, future research directions on evaluation and improving the physicochemical properties of biochar catalysts were proposed as well as their potential applications in real wastewater systems.
